SHILLONG: North Shillong MLA Adelbert Nongrum has petitioned the Managing Director of Meghalaya Energy Corporation Limited (MeECL) urging the official to create a dedicated web portal for catering specifically towards the defunct streetlights in the state.
Taking cognizance of the inoperative streetlights in the constituency, the MLA advised the MeECL to dedicate a toll free helpline which would help in making immediate rectifications.
The MLA is also of the view that metering of streetlights would help in unnecessary wastage of power and help in detecting power theft.
He has also asked the Corporation to ensure the maintenance of inventory so that materials do not run out of stock.
